This is an announcement of the *second* release candidate for the much awaited OpenSimulator 0.9, opensim-0.9.0.0-rc2. As usual, the release packages can be found in [1].<br>
<br>
0.9.0.0 includes all the code donated by Avination about one year ago, as well as several more improvements made since then. The code was a bit unstable as we worked through thousands of merged commits, and correspondent regressions, but we feel it is now stable enough to cut a release out of it. Many people have already been using it for a few months, including OSGrid.<br>
<br>
rc2 contains many fixes identified in rc1, including some important permissions issues.<br>
<br>
We're still working on the release notes [2].<br>
<br>
We appreciate people trying out this release candidate and reporting any issues back to us via mantis. We are particularly sensitive to regressions -- things that worked in 0.8.2 and stopped working in 0.9.0.<br>
